Abstract
The utility model provides a kind of Waterproof battery management system and power battery power-supply system, is related to technical field of battery management, which includes shell, main control module and multiple from control module;Multiple connectors are provided on shell;Main control module is arranged in shell, and main control module is connect by connector with from control module;The seam crossing of shell is filled with marine glue, is provided with waterproof pad in connector.For plug-in main control module; the Waterproof battery management system is by being arranged main control module in shell; and shell carries out waterproof using the multi-faceted waterproof type of the waterproof pad in the marine glue and connector of seam crossing; main control module is effectively protected not by the invasion of water; the waterproof effect of battery management system is improved, to improve the service life of battery management system.

Battery management system (BMS, BATTERY MANAGEMENT SYSTEM) is the tie between battery and user, main
Wanting object is secondary cell, mainly aims at the utilization rate that can be improved battery, prevents battery from occurring overcharging and excessively
Electric discharge, can be used for electric car, battery truck, robot, unmanned plane etc..
BMS is generally divided into main control module (previous module) and from control module (second level module) two parts, main from control module
The acquisition and Balance route, main control module for being responsible for the monitoring data such as cell voltage, temperature, electric current are mainly responsible for SOC (State
Of Charge, state-of-charge) estimation, relay driving and electrical injury protection.Main control module with from control module by height can
The data transmission channel leaned on carries out the transmitted in both directions of instruction with data.A set of BMS by a main control module and several from control mould
The number of block composition, usage quantity and battery cell from control module is positively correlated.Main control module can be set in battery case,
(plug-in) is can be set outside battery case.For plug-in main control module, since it is exposed to outside, when encounter rainy day or
When plum rain season, main control module is highly susceptible to the invasion of water, easily causes internal short circuit and etching electronic in this way
Element, influences the service life of BMS, will lead to BMS paralysis when serious.

Embodiment one:
The utility model embodiment provides a kind of Waterproof battery management system, which includes shell
Body, main control module and it is multiple from control module.
Specifically, the material of shell can be, but not limited to as plastics.Multiple connectors are provided on shell, main control module is set
It sets in shell, main control module is connect by connector with from control module, to carry out the transmitted in both directions of instruction with data.From control mould
The usage quantity of block and the number of battery cell are positively correlated, and general pure electric vehicle passenger car is needed from control module 4 or so, pure electric vehicle
Car needs 8-10 to differ from control module, here without limitation to the quantity from control module.In addition here to of connector
Several and type is also without limitation.It is each to be arranged in battery case from control module in some possible embodiments, and and battery case
Interior power battery connection.
The seam crossing of shell is filled with marine glue, is provided with waterproof pad in connector.Wherein, marine glue can with but it is unlimited
In for water-proof silica-gel, waterproof pad be can be, but not limited to as water-proof silica-gel pad, i.e., the material of marine glue and waterproof pad can be with
Using waterproof, moisture-proof, the preferable silica gel of dust-proof effect.Here without limitation to the shape of shell, such as the shape of shell can be with
For cuboid, square, cylindrical body etc..By by main control module be arranged in the shell, can be improved main control module waterproof,
Dust-proof effect.
In the present embodiment, for plug-in main control module, the Waterproof battery management system is by existing main control module setting
In shell, and shell is prevented using the multi-faceted waterproof type of the waterproof pad in the marine glue and connector of seam crossing
Water is effectively protected main control module not by the invasion of water, improves the waterproof effect of battery management system, to improve electricity
The service life of pond management system.
Based on the basic structure of above-mentioned Waterproof battery management system, the utility model embodiment additionally provides Waterproof battery pipe
A kind of specific structure of shell of reason system.As shown in Figure 1, above-mentioned shell includes upper housing 101 and lower case 102, Ge Gejie
Plug-in unit 104 is arranged in lower case 102.By male-female engagement body upper-lower seal, which matches for upper housing 101 and lower case 102
Waterproof apron 103 is provided in zoarium.
In some possible embodiments, above-mentioned male-female engagement body includes the groove that 101 bottom of upper housing is arranged in, and
The boss at 102 top of lower case is set, is provided with waterproof apron 103 on the inner sidewall of groove.The boss passes through waterproof apron
103 are installed in groove.By this male-female engagement body structure and waterproof apron 103, so that upper housing 101 and lower case 102
It is in close contact, steam can be effectively prevented and enter enclosure interior.
In order to further increase the compactness that waterproof apron 103 is bonded with upper housing 101, above-mentioned waterproof apron 103 and recessed
The inner sidewall of slot is provided with the threaded line for the horizontal distribution being mutually matched, and upper housing 101 passes through the threaded line and waterproof apron 103
It fits closely.By being bonded waterproof apron 103 closely with upper housing 101, the Waterproof battery pipe is further improved
Waterproof effect of the reason system to main control module.
Fig. 2 is a kind of structural representation of another shell of Waterproof battery management system provided by the embodiment of the utility model
Figure, as shown in Fig. 2, check the temperature of main control module for the ease of user, the top surface of above-mentioned shell (namely the upper housing in Fig. 1
101 top surface) on be disposed with wear-resisting waterproof layer 201 and heat discoloration layer 202 from outside to inside, wherein wear-resisting waterproof layer 201
For transparent material.
In some possible embodiments, the material of above-mentioned wear-resisting waterproof layer 201 includes that the transparent wears such as tempered glass are anti-
Water material.The material of heat discoloration layer 202 (can be commonly called as reversible temperature-sensitive camouflage paint:Warm variable pigments, temperature-sensitive powder or temperature become
Powder), heat discoloration layer 202 can change the color of itself by perceiving the temperature of enclosure interior main control module, therefore this is anti-
Water battery management system can intuitively show its temperature height by heat discoloration layer 202.User can pass through observation in this way
The color of shell quickly judges the current reference temperature of main control module, and intuitive and convenient improves user experience.
In view of the load-bearing problem of shell, in some possible embodiments, wear-resisting waterproof layer 201 and heat discoloration layer
Pressure sensor is additionally provided between 202.Fig. 3 is a kind of electricity of Waterproof battery management system provided by the embodiment of the utility model
Road connection schematic diagram, as shown in figure 3, main control module 301 is connect with each from control module 302, pressure sensor 303 and master control mould
Block 301 connects.Pressure sensor 303 is sent to main control module 301 for detecting the pressure value born on shell.Master control mould
Received pressure value can be sent to host computer, user is made to understand the compression situation of shell by block 301 by connecting host computer.
Further, as shown in figure 3, being additionally provided with alarm 304 in above-mentioned shell, alarm 304 and main control module 301
Connection.Main control module 301 is used to alarm when received pressure value is greater than preset pressure threshold by alarm 304.
Specifically, alarm 304 can be, but not limited to as combined aural and visual alarm.Preset pressure is stored in main control module 301
Force threshold, the pressure threshold is corresponding with the load-bearing capacity of shell, and pressure threshold can be arranged in user according to the actual situation.Work as master control
When the received pressure value of module 301 (pressure value that shell is currently born) is greater than the pressure threshold, illustrate what shell was currently born
Pressure is overweight, and main control module 301 sends alarm command to alarm 304 at this time, and it is laggard that alarm 304 receives the alarm command
Row alarm.User's shell can be reminded to bear the overweight problem of pressure in time in this way, reduced to shell (even to main control module
301) damage.
